How Does EIP 1559 Work?
Under the new fee market mechanism, users pay a base fee for their transactions, which is burned as part of the transaction process. This base fee is determined by the network’s congestion level, ensuring that high-traffic periods result in higher fees. Additionally, users can include a tip for the miners, which is not burned but rewards them for their work.
Here’s a step-by-step breakdown of how EIP 1559 works:
- When you initiate a transaction, you specify the amount of ETH you want to send and the gas limit.
- The network calculates the base fee based on the current congestion level.
- You pay the base fee and any additional tip to the miner.
- The base fee is burned, reducing the total supply of ETH.
- The miner receives the tip as a reward.
